Spackle all of the holes that you have in the walls. First, go to a home improvement center and buy spackle. You will probably only need to use a small bit. If the hole is really small, then you can use something as small as a bobby pin to apply spackle onto it. After your spackle has dried, use some sandpaper or even a credit card to smooth everything out and make the wall look new again. Then, apply paint to the area. Any holes in your walls will disappear right before your eyes!

When in the process of searching for a home, there are several problems that you can visibly see, such as chipping paint, bad ceilings, and rotting decks. Poor ventilation or electrical issues will only be located by a trained eye. When you invest in proper inspection in advance, you save money on potential repairs in the long run.

To enhance the curb appeal of your home, give your garage door a fresh coat of paint. Garage doors are easily worn and dingy due to regular exposure to things like sun and rain. New paint instantly transforms the look of a home and increases it's value. If your home's color is a bit boring, try painting the garage door a complimentary color to give it a bit more zest.
